Think back over the jobs you’ve held in the past. Which ones stand out as the best, most challenging, and rewarding? Which ones were plain misery? In retrospect, there’s probably one constant that separated the good jobs from those that were horrendous: Your boss.

A good boss can inspire you to great achievement, while a bad boss can be thoroughly demotivating and make your life a living hell.

The qualities most often associated with good managers include fairness, compassion, supportiveness, consistency, and the ability to inspire workers to deliver their best. And while you might think these are innate qualities, they aren’t; these are skills that anyone can work to develop, regardless of their natural temperament or experience.
